Materials:
To make a pink crochet bikini, you’ll need the following materials:
- Pink crochet yarn cakes
- Crochet hook
- Scissors
- Tape measure
- Sewing needle and thread

Instructions:
- Begin by taking your measurements. Measure your bust, waist, and hips, as well as the length of the bikini top and bottom that you desire.
- Using your bust measurement, crochet a chain that is the length of your bust circumference plus 2 inches. Slip stitch to join the chain into a circle.
- Crochet one round of single crochet stitches around the circle. Slip stitch to join the round.
- Chain 3 stitches and then double crochet 1 stitch into each stitch from the previous round. Slip stitch to join the round.
- Continue to crochet in this pattern, adding additional rounds until the bikini top reaches your desired length.
- Repeat steps 2-5 to create the crochet bikini bottom.
- Once the top and bottom are complete, sew them together using a sewing needle and thread.
- Cut the yarn and weave in the ends using a tapestry needle.
